Is Motley Fool's premium subscription worth it? Motley Fool's Stock Advisor has outperformed the market by 382% and it costs $199 per year. This premium subscription provides you with two stock recommendations each month. But Stock Advisor is its flagship premium plan. Motley Fool offers tons of plans and other products. Its team writes all the articles of expert analysts. The platform also provides articles that can help you learn more about investing. The platform essentially does the research for you. Motley Fool is best for new investors with little time to do their own research. Brothers Tom and David Gardner founded Motley Fool in 1993. Motley Fool is an investment advisory platform providing stock recommendations and analysis. What Is Motley Fool and How Does It Work? Seeking Alpha's "Strong Buy" picks have outperformed the market by 4x (as of 2023) and the premium subscription costs $239 per year. Providing you with objective metrics to screen and choose stocks.Informing you of what other investors think.This helps you weigh the pros and cons of investing in a company.īasically, Seeking Alpha empowers you to make your own investment decision. Knowing what the investing community thinks is beneficial. Seeking Alpha's editors then curate this content to ensure quality. Seeking Alpha's community of investors also share their insights on why they bought or sold a stock. Seeking Alpha's premium plan provides stock ratings and screeners to help you pick stocks. This is best for investors who want to do their own research. David Jackson, who previously worked as an investment researcher, launched the platform in 2004. Seeking Alpha is an investment research platform showcasing crowdsourced stock analysis and stock-picking tools. What Is Seeking Alpha and How Does It Work?
